Step 1: Understand the Game Mechanics
Before diving into strategies, it’s essential to grasp how Keno works. Here’s a breakdown of the mechanics:
- Number Selection: Players typically choose between 1 to 20 numbers from a pool of 80.
- Drawing: 20 numbers are drawn randomly, similar to a lottery.
- Payouts: The amount you win depends on how many numbers you match, with varying payouts for different amounts matched.

Step 6: Managing Your Bankroll
Effective bankroll management is vital for long-term success. Consider the following tips:
- Set a Budget: Decide on a specific amount to spend and stick to it.
- Play Lower Stakes: If you’re a beginner, opt for smaller bets to extend your playtime.
- Know When to Quit: If you’re on a losing streak, it’s wise to step away and revisit the game later.
